Video: Roush Vs. Saleen Shoot Out
Watch retired racing driver Derek Hill test the 2007 Roush 427R against the 2007 Saleen S281 Supercharged. Both vehicles were attained though Grand Prairie Ford in Texas.
Test car “may” be 07-0095. [Source: Web Rides TV] |

Good video comparo, Dave.
I was a little surprised the Roush beat the Saleen like it did, especially since the Saleen easily had the Roush on paper. It really makes me wonder if the numbers are correct. The other thing that came to mind was the unsprung weight and rotational inertia of the large chrome 20s the Saleen was sporting. I'd like to see how the Saleen would do with some lightweight forged wheels. |

By the time the above video was produced, 12/12/07... ASC/Saleen was operating. If they knew this was taking place, the ASC executives probably did not ask any questions. Roush was known to underrate vehicles and Saleen was known to overrate. Quote:
For pricing... I think the Stage 3 would have been better matched to the S281 S/C. The R package Roush was something Saleen did not compete with until the 2008 Red Flag & American Flag Editions. |
